Transaction 48d13f064ccffdc77c81ff10e5341bd41ae423e662962c86a2095d13ccc07106

200 Input
1 Outputs
  • 48d13f064ccffdc77c81ff10e5341bd41ae423e662962c86a2095d13ccc07106:0
  • value  456030420
    address  361A1vrMwbbHfEmsRYMRYpUmSfuHg6aSEN